{
  "bucket": "2026-02-10_0710",
  "generated_at": "2026-02-22T16:31:19.383899",
  "total_trades": 45,
  "start_ts": "2026-02-10T07:10:00",
  "end_ts": "2026-02-10T07:19:59",
  "stats": {
    "total": 45,
    "closed": 45,
    "wins": 38,
    "losses": 7,
    "opens": 0,
    "gross_win": 3.4899999999999998,
    "gross_loss": -2.4499999999999997,
    "net_profit": 1.04,
    "total_stake": 42.7,
    "win_rate": 84.44444444444444,
    "avg_profit": 0.023111111111111114,
    "profit_factor": 1.4244897959183673,
    "roi": 2.4355971896955504,
    "first_ts": "2026-02-10 07:10:26",
    "last_ts": "2026-02-10 07:19:34",
    "max_drawdown": 0.35,
    "max_drawdown_pct": 25.179856115107896,
    "consecutive_wins": 13,
    "consecutive_losses": 1,
    "largest_win": 0.41,
    "largest_loss": -0.35
  },
  "trades": [
    {
      "id": 2470,
      "contract_id": "306197411868",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:10:26"
    },
    {
      "id": 2471,
      "contract_id": "306197419408",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:10:34"
    },
    {
      "id": 2472,
      "contract_id": "306197426588",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:10:42"
    },
    {
      "id": 2473,
      "contract_id": "306197463988",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:11:26"
    },
    {
      "id": 2474,
      "contract_id": "306197471288",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:11:34"
    },
    {
      "id": 2475,
      "contract_id": "306197477688",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:11:42"
    },
    {
      "id": 2476,
      "contract_id": "306197484388",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:11:50"
    },
    {
      "id": 2477,
      "contract_id": "306197490808",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:11:58"
    },
    {
      "id": 2478,
      "contract_id": "306197499088",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:06"
    },
    {
      "id": 2479,
      "contract_id": "306197506248",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:14"
    },
    {
      "id": 2480,
      "contract_id": "306197513348",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:22"
    },
    {
      "id": 2481,
      "contract_id": "306197522508",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:30"
    },
    {
      "id": 2482,
      "contract_id": "306197531788",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:38"
    },
    {
      "id": 2483,
      "contract_id": "306197541308",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:46"
    },
    {
      "id": 2484,
      "contract_id": "306197550388",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:12:54"
    },
    {
      "id": 2485,
      "contract_id": "306197558188",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:13:02"
    },
    {
      "id": 2486,
      "contract_id": "306197564848",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:13:10"
    },
    {
      "id": 2487,
      "contract_id": "306197601568",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:13:52"
    },
    {
      "id": 2488,
      "contract_id": "306197613668",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:14:00"
    },
    {
      "id": 2489,
      "contract_id": "306197619388",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:14:06"
    },
    {
      "id": 2490,
      "contract_id": "306197654068",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:14:48"
    },
    {
      "id": 2491,
      "contract_id": "306197661108",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:14:56"
    },
    {
      "id": 2492,
      "contract_id": "306197669168",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:15:04"
    },
    {
      "id": 2493,
      "contract_id": "306197706108",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:15:46"
    },
    {
      "id": 2494,
      "contract_id": "306197711228",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:15:52"
    },
    {
      "id": 2495,
      "contract_id": "306197719048",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:15:59"
    },
    {
      "id": 2496,
      "contract_id": "306197725968",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:06"
    },
    {
      "id": 2497,
      "contract_id": "306197730928",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:12"
    },
    {
      "id": 2498,
      "contract_id": "306197737208",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:20"
    },
    {
      "id": 2499,
      "contract_id": "306197744068",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:28"
    },
    {
      "id": 2500,
      "contract_id": "306197750788",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:36"
    },
    {
      "id": 2501,
      "contract_id": "306197757308",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:44"
    },
    {
      "id": 2502,
      "contract_id": "306197762488",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:50"
    },
    {
      "id": 2503,
      "contract_id": "306197769668",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:16:58"
    },
    {
      "id": 2504,
      "contract_id": "306197778128",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:17:06"
    },
    {
      "id": 2505,
      "contract_id": "306197819988",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:17:50"
    },
    {
      "id": 2506,
      "contract_id": "306197828828",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:17:58"
    },
    {
      "id": 2507,
      "contract_id": "306197836188",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:18:06"
    },
    {
      "id": 2508,
      "contract_id": "306197844368",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:18:14"
    },
    {
      "id": 2509,
      "contract_id": "306197885468",
      "type": "DIFF",
      "stake": 4.2,
      "profit": 0.41,
      "status": "WON",
      "timestamp": "2026-02-10T07:18:56"
    },
    {
      "id": 2510,
      "contract_id": "306197894388",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:19:04"
    },
    {
      "id": 2511,
      "contract_id": "306197901388",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:19:12"
    },
    {
      "id": 2512,
      "contract_id": "306197909068",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:19:20"
    },
    {
      "id": 2513,
      "contract_id": "306197915528",
      "type": "DIFF",
      "stake": 0.35,
      "profit": 0.02,
      "status": "WON",
      "timestamp": "2026-02-10T07:19:28"
    },
    {
      "id": 2514,
      "contract_id": "306197920248",
      "type": "DIFF",
      "stake": 0.35,
      "profit": -0.35,
      "status": "LOST",
      "timestamp": "2026-02-10T07:19:34"
    }
  ]
}